This acquisition involves working with highly-skilled ocean dynamics modeling that will incorporate innovative computational numerical techniques and data assimilation approaches to support the Ocean Sciences Division, Code 7300. The scope of this effort encompasses data collection from near-real time, in situ underwater sensors or via remote sensing at high resolution, and assimilating data into reliable, three-dimensional models and multi-horizon or extended forecasts. The purpose for this Request for Proposals (RFP) is procure the personnel support needed to conduct research regarding the various functional support areas, including Remote Sensing Exploitation, Sea Surface Temperature, Ocean and Atmosphere Coupling and Processes, and Regional Ocean Circulation, to name a few. For each functional support area, the contractor shall also develop higher quality data for input and assimilation with innovative approaches, especially those that can extend the capabilities of existing assets. The Government anticipates award of a Cost Plus Fixed Fee contract. This procurement is a re-compete effort for current contract N00173-17-C-6011, which was awarded to Vencore, Inc. (now Peraton).
